Secured Creditors definition

Secured Creditors shall have the meaning assigned that term in the respective Security Documents.
Secured Creditors shall have the meaning provided in the recitals of this Agreement.
Secured Creditors means, collectively, the Administrative Agents, the Collateral Agent, the Lenders, the Issuing Banks and each Secured Bank Product Provider.
